Junior Construction Manager
As a Junior Construction Manager, you will be responsible for assisting in the planning, coordination, and management of construction projects in Abu-Dhabi. You will work closely with the senior management team to ensure that proj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ards. This is a full-time position suitable for English-speaking candidates from Egypt who are looking to start their career in construction management. Prior experience is not required as on-the-job training will be provided.
Responsibilities:
- Assist in the preparation of project schedules, budgets, and resource plans
- Coordinate with contractors, suppliers, and other stakeholders to ensure smooth project execution
- Monitor progress of construction activities and identify potential issues or delays
- Work with technical teams to review and approve project designs and specifications
- Ensure compliance with safety regulations and quality standards
- Prepare progress reports and communicate updates to senior management
- Assist in managing project finances including cost control measures
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ering or related field (preferred)
- Proficiency in English language (spoken and written)
- Good organizational skills with the 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ively
- Strong communication skills and ability to work well in a team environment
- Basic knowledge of construction processes, materials, and techniques (preferred)
- Willingness to learn and take on new responsibilities
